Output 627df5103333a8122c451f6333d14c66acb66e37e5d271d4d3637496227f466c:0

value
164944551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ae9c3501879d105c04c951a6b01daea3bd6ee7 OP_EQUAL
address
3Kz8F3ARFtU3v1kvLKNkFgq4L3H2wAaRCr
transaction
627df5103333a8122c451f6333d14c66acb66e37e5d271d4d3637496227f466c
spent
true